The ATMEGA325V is a specialized integrated circuit microcontroller produced by Atmel (now part of Microchip Technology), designed for advanced embedded system applications requiring high-performance and low-power consumption. This versatile microcontroller is part of the AVR family of 8-bit microcontrollers, offering robust functionality in a compact QFP (Quad Flat Package) format.
The device is engineered to provide efficient processing capabilities with advanced power management features, making it particularly suitable for applications that demand precise control and energy optimization. Its advanced architecture allows for complex computational tasks while maintaining low power consumption, which is critical in modern electronic design.

ATMEGA325V Features
The ATMEGA325V delivers a comprehensive array of features, including a high-performance, low-power AVR 8-bit microcontroller architecture, which allows for efficient processing and power management. The chip supports a flexible set of digital I/O, several integrated timers/counters, SPI, I2C, and USART serial interfaces. Additionally, it includes on-chip oscillators, watchdog timer, and advanced interrupt handling. The device operates over a wide voltage range and is designed for high noise immunity, which is essential in demanding industrial and automotive applications. Its robust program memory and ample SRAM/EEPROM resources enable the development of complex embedded firmware, supporting a broad array of communication and control protocols.
